<br /> 56 I <br /> RESOLUTION 1994- 17 R <br /> A RESOLUTION OF TH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F SAN <br /> MARCOSr TEXASr APPROVING AN EMERGENCY PROCUREMENT <br /> OF SERVICES FOR THE INSTALLATION OF REPLACEMENT <br /> WATER VALVES IN DOWNTOWN SAN MARCOS IN ORDER TO <br /> PRESERVE AND PROTECT THE PUBLIC HEALTH AND SAFETY <br /> OF THE CITyrS RESIDENTS¡ APPROVING THE TERMS AND <br /> CONDITIONS OF AN AGREEMENT WITH MINEOLA VALVE AND <br /> HYD RA.1\TT COMP A.L\IY ¡ AUTHORIZING THE CITY MANAGER TO <br /> EXECUTE THE AGREEMENT ON BEHALF OF THE CITY; AND <br /> DECLARING AN EFFECTIVE DATE. <br /> RECITALS: <br /> 1. Approximately 31 water valves have been closed <br /> in downtowriSan Marcos in an attempt to shut down the water <br /> distribution system to allow Du-Mor Enterprises, Inc. <br /> (IIDu-Morll) to abandon old water mains in conjunction with the <br /> Downtown Water System Improvements Project. <br /> 2. Not enough of the 31 valves have been <br /> operational to permit Du-Mor to make the necessary <br /> connections to complete the project. . <br /> 3. Mineola Valve and Hydrant Co. uses a <br /> proprietary process which allows for the installation of a <br /> new valve on an active water main. <br /> 4. The installation of valves using this process <br /> will allow the Downtown Water System Improvements Project to <br /> be completed and water service to be provided to the downtown <br /> area using the new mains. <br /> BE IT RESOLVED BY TH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F <br /> SAN MARCOS r TEXAS: <br /> PART 1. That the emergency procurement of services <br /> for the installation of water valves in connection with the <br /> Downtown Water System Improvements Project to preserve and <br /> protect the public health and safety of the Cityrs residents <br /> is approved. <br /> PART 2. That an agreement between the City and <br /> Mineola Valve and Hydrant Company for the installation of <br /> replacement water valvesr a copy of which is attached to and <br /> incorporated in this Resolution for all intents and purposesr <br /> is approved. <br /> PART 3. That the City Managerr Larry D. Gil1eYr is <br /> authorized to execute the attached agreement on behalf of <br /> the City. <br /> PART 4. That this Resolution shall be in full <br /> force and effect immediately from and after its passage. <br /> ADOPTED this the 24th day of January 1994.' <br /> ~r~t ~ <br /> Mayor <br /> Attest :~ <br /> f ¡}v/'.' :Ie : Ø' /£r.M,/» <br /> Janis K. omack <br /> City Secretary <br />
